Tupelo Broccoli Quiche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  

PARTIALLY BAKE PIECRUST (I USUALLY DON’T)

SAUTE 4 C. CHOPPED BROCCOLI WITH 1C. FINELY CHOPPED ONION. STIR IN 1/2 C. CHOPPED PARSLEY, 1/2 t. SALT, PEPPER, 1/4t. GARLIC SALT, 1/4t. BASIL, AND 1/4 t. OREGANO.

COOL SLIGHTLY.

MIX 1/2 C. MAYONNAISE, 1/2 C. MILK, 2 BEATEN EGGS, 1 T. CORNSTARCH. ADD 2 C. GRATED SWISS CHEESE. CAREFULLY STIR INTO BROCOLLI MIXTURE.

Directions:
Directions:
PUT INTO PARTIALLY BAKED CRUST.

BAKE @ 375 DEGREES, ABOUT 25-30 MINUTES, OR UNTIL DONE.
